Ukraine and Russia accuse each other of shelling Zaporizhia NPP – Ukraine

Kyiv (Kyiv)/Moscow – The situation around the Ukrainian nuclear power plant Zaporizhia remains tense: Ukraine and Russia once more blamed each other for attacks on Europe’s largest nuclear power plant at the weekend. Artillery shells have landed in the town of Enerhodar, which is close to the Russian-occupied nuclear power plant. This was announced by Russian and Ukrainian sources. Both sides blamed the other for the shelling.
